Kinds of Headphones
When shopping for headphones, it's vital to consider the range of types offered, as they serve different purposes and offer distinct listening experiences. The primary classifications of headphones consist of:
Over-Ear Headphones: These headphones frame the ear and provide superior sound quality due to their bigger chauffeurs and noise seclusion features.
On-Ear Headphones: These rest on the ear but do not cover it completely. They are frequently lighter and more portable than over-ear designs but may allow more ambient sound in.
In-Ear Headphones (Earbuds): Compact and convenient, these in shape directly within the ear canal. They are frequently chosen for their mobility, making them ideal for active users.
Wireless Headphones: These headphones link to devices by means of Bluetooth, offering the liberty of movement without the trouble of tangled wires. They can be available in over-ear, on-ear, or in-ear forms.
Noise-Canceling Headphones: Equipped with innovation to minimize ambient sounds, these headphones are perfect for travelers or those who wish to immerse themselves in audio without distractions.
The following table sums up these types with their crucial features:
Type | Sound Quality | Sound Isolation | Portability | Best Use |
---|---|---|---|---|
Over-Ear | Exceptional | High | Low | Home/Studio Use |
On-Ear | Good | Moderate | Moderate | Daily Commute |
In-Ear (Earbuds) | Good | Low | High | Active Lifestyle |
Wireless | Variable | Variable | High | General Use |
Noise-Canceling | Excellent | Excellent | Moderate | Travel/Focus |

Popular Brands and Models
The headphones market is saturated with numerous brands and models, each offering special features and sound signatures. Here are some of the most popular brand names to consider:
Bose: Renowned for their noise-canceling innovation, with models like the Bose QuietComfort 35 II offering premium noise and convenience.
Sony: Offers a variety of premium wireless choices, especially the Sony WH-1000XM series, known for their excellent sound quality and noise-canceling capabilities.
Sennheiser: Esteemed for studio-quality headphones, designs like the Sennheiser HD 660S supply audiophiles with a rich listening experience.
Apple: Known for the AirPods and AirPods Pro, which effortlessly integrate with Apple's environment while offering good sound quality and convenience.
JBL: Offers budget-friendly choices with strong sound efficiency, making them an excellent choice for casual listeners.
Contrast Table of Popular Models
Brand name | Design | Type | Noise-Canceling | Battery Life | Price Range |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Bose | QuietComfort 35 II | Over-Ear | Yes | Up to 20 hours | ₤ 300 - ₤ 350 |
Sony | WH-1000XM4 | Over-Ear | Yes | Up to 30 hours | ₤ 350 - ₤ 400 |
Sennheiser | HD 660S | Over-Ear | No | N/A | ₤ 400 - ₤ 500 |
Apple | AirPods Pro | In-Ear | Yes | Up to 4.5 hours (+24 hours with case) | ₤ 250 - ₤ 300 |
JBL | Tune 750BTNC | On-Ear | Yes | Up to 15 hours | ₤ 150 - ₤ 200 |
Frequently asked questions About Headphones
What is the very best kind of headphone for music production?
- Over-ear headphones, especially those designed for studio use (like the Sennheiser HD 660S) are ideal for music production due to their sound quality and convenience during extended sessions.
Are wireless headphones worth it?
- Yes, wireless headphones use greater flexibility of movement and benefit, especially for active way of lives or travel.
How can I improve the sound quality of my headphones?
- Utilizing a top quality audio source (like lossless audio files) and an external headphone amplifier can substantially boost sound quality.
What is the difference in between passive and active sound canceling?
- Passive noise canceling includes physically blocking sound with padding, while active sound canceling uses microphones and electronic circuitry to lower background sound.
How do I maintain my headphones?
- Routinely tidy ear cups and cushions, store headphones effectively, and prevent exposing them to extreme temperatures or wetness.
